Master room with fitted wardrobes and in similar style to rest of flat with Moroccan/Spanish contemporary furniture and mirrors. It has luxurious views of pool and tropical gardens from full length doors onto a Juliet balcony. This bedroom has an on-suite bathroom fully marbled in pink and grey with stunning walk-in shower with glass doors. Floors are cool white marble with walls to match. The second bedroom is again decorated in same style as rest of flat with masses of wardrobe space. It has its own bathroom in grey marble. The bedroom has a leafy view over gardens to the rear of the apartment through glass doors onto a Juliet balcony.

I love the Estepona / Marbella area and lived there for a year when I was studying so I know it well. It has absolutely everything from the culture of a beautiful University City (Malaga) to the picturesque shops of the old town of Marbella, the bleached, remote, beaches of Tarifa to shopping in Puerta Banus. It has of course an amazing climate even in the winter its usually sunny. I love the Spanish architecture of the holiday homes with their tropical gardens and pools. We don't find see this plethera of luxury holiday homes in France or other European countries. I feel my apartment reflects Spanish and Moroccan influences of the area. Everything in my property has been chosen with extreme care. I've really tried to capture an exotic but contemporary feel. I notice, everyone who stays leaves something interesting on the mantlepiece they have found on the beach as though they too have captured the environment in someway, shells or stones or smoothed pieces of coloured glass. I never tired of exploring the area, the shops, the bars, the restaurants, the markets, the villages, and even the mountains. This part of Spain gives me everything I need. Even at Christmas or New Year, there is life and fiestas in the street or even lunch on the beach. Every season offers something and even in the winter I can light a fire, crack open a bottle of red wine and watch the sun set or watch some good TV on Sky. What I love about are this area is it multi-faceted quality. When I lived there I had friends visit me constantly for different reasons. Some where on business, some passing through and some on holiday. This is both a connected cosmopolitan convergeance point and a beautiful retreat... what more could you want? Ski-ing? Its got that too!!
What makes this Apartment unique
When I bought this property I searched all over the Marbella / Estepona area for what I was looking for. I thought of buying a propery up in the hills, in a town, on a golf course or buying up an old farm. After a long day's hunting in the dry heat and with a brain on overload I remember looking down at all the brochures on the floor of my hirecar. There was one property which stood out from all the others. It looked tropical, exotic, peaceful, and attractive and most of all, in that moment, the pool looked heavenly inviting. The next day I went back to the development. There was one perfect apartment left overlooking the pool and near the beach. It had a mexican / hispanic to it, with white marble and walls everywhere and a terracotta terrace. I felt transported. I went to the beach restaurant to have lunch with some friends to decide. It was a perfect day, with a gentle wind, there was some Spanish music playing. People were gliding through the water as they swam and small cabin cruisers were dropping anchor to come ashore for lunch. The water was flat and I could see the hill of Tangiers in Morocca across from Gibraltar. There was no doubt now that to be near the beach was a luxury I wanted as part of my property. This was different to any other beach because it was secluded by woods and seemed off the beaten track, but near all the exciting places. The apartment felt like an oasis in the busyness of Marbella, which, if I needed, was on my doorstep. I've had the apartment for nine years now and I still marvel at how perfect it is, very tranquil but right in the middle of all the action.
